Commencement Information

A student may participate in Commencement exercises if:  he/she expects to complete outstanding program course work of not more than one course (up to four credits), is achieving a cumulative grade point average (CGPA) of 2.00 based on previous semester grades, and is meeting all other requirements. The degree will be mailed to the student following completion of all requirements.

Students who plan to participate in the Commencement ceremony must complete a cap and gown order form, available at the Office of Student Affairs or the Office of the Registrar.

Academic Distinction

Honors designations for recognition at Commencement are determined using the CGPA earned at the end of the semester prior to the last semester of enrollment before graduation. CGPA requirements for honors are not rounded.

Bachelor Candidates

(typically the seventh semester of full-time enrollment):
Cum Laude: CGPA Range 3.50-3.69
Magna Cum Laude: CGPA Range 3.70-3.89
Summa Cum Laude: CGPA Range 3.90-4.00

Associate Candidates

(typically the third semester of full-time enrollment):
Honors: CGPA range 3.50 – 3.69
High Honors: CGPA range 3.70 – 3.89
Highest Honors: CGPA Range 3.90 – 4.00

Students should apply for their degrees at the time they meet the requirements. Students applying for the associate’s degree at the same time the bachelor’s degree is awarded may only be recognized in the program for degrees and honors relevant to the period covered by that Commencement. For example, an associate’s degree for which the student met the requirements at the end of the spring 2011 semester will not be included in the 2012 Commencement, regardless of whether the student chose to be recognized in 2011 or not. However, the degree may still be awarded.
